Description

Aster ericoides 'Esther' is a charming variety with many advantages. It forms a dense and spreading bush with long stems. It produces an abundant autumn flowering. The soft pink petal colour blends beautifully with the golden yellow heart of the flowerheads. The very fine leaves resemble those of heather, giving a lot of lightness to this perennial that adds beauty to the garden long before the flowers appear.

 

Aster ericoides are good, hardy, perennial plants with very limited requirements. They do not require staking and are not very susceptible to diseases. They do not need to be divided and integrate perfectly into mixed borders with any type of perennials. A beautiful and long flowering period, decorative foliage in summer, and very few requirements, make 'Esther' a must-have for all aster enthusiasts.

Planting and care

Plant in autumn or spring in moist but well-drained ordinary soil, even clayey or stony. It can tolerate occasional drought. It prefers a sunny exposure but can tolerate partial shade where it will have a slightly looser habit. It is important to avoid strong winds that could flatten the clumps. In a flower bed, maintain a spacing of at least 50cm (20in) between plants. This plant tends to produce suckers, so it may be necessary to contain its growth as it tends to spread when it is happy.
